Com es resolen els controladors de WiFi a Linux



Proveu El Nostre Instrument Per Eliminar Problemes

De vegades, els controladors de Wi-Fi poden ser difícils de configurar a Linux, fins i tot si funcionen d’una altra manera quan inicieu l’ordinador amb una versió de Microsoft Windows o un altre sistema operatiu. És possible que trobeu que un adaptador de xarxa sense fils no es connecta automàticament o fins i tot podeu trobar que heu de fer clic a la icona de connexió més d’una vegada en un entorn gràfic perquè funcioni. En general, el que està passant és que el sistema no fa un sondatge suficient al conductor.



Al principi, assegureu-vos que esteu executant els controladors més recents per al vostre maquinari i, si això no funciona, doneu una ullada al syslog per veure si es produeix alguna cosa inusual. De vegades, els controladors es poden restablir periòdicament. Excepte tot això, tindreu un altre recurs. El syslog és un bon lloc per començar, però la seva ubicació pot ser diferent en diferents distribucions de Linux.



Mètode 1: inspeccionar el fitxer syslog per detectar errors del controlador sense fils

Si utilitzeu Debian, qualsevol versió d’Ubuntu independentment de la interfície gràfica de l’escriptori o qualsevol altra distribució derivada de Debian com Bodhi o Trisquel, podeu provar tail -f per fer una ullada a la darrera part del fitxer i veure si hi ha alguna referència al controlador de WiFi. L'interruptor -f garanteix que si passa alguna cosa mentre ho mireu, continuareu veient-lo a mesura que aparegui. Tingueu en compte que si veieu una sèrie de desconnexions repetides al controlador de WiFi, és molt probable que sigui un problema de maquinari i us assegureu que el dispositiu estigui correctament connectat al sistema físic. Si veieu una sèrie de connexions USB, és probable que això tingui poc a veure amb les funcions de xarxa que ofereix el nucli. Si veieu un missatge com ara:



S'ha trobat un nou dispositiu USB

2

Noves cadenes de dispositius USB

Aleshores, més que probable és que es refereixin als dispositius d’emmagatzematge massiu que esteu connectant i separant del sistema. Tanmateix, presteu molta atenció a aquells que comencen amb una data i contenen 'Dispositiu USB nou trobat' si l'adaptador WiFi està connectat mitjançant un port USB.



Si utilitzeu Fedora o qualsevol cosa que estigui basada en Fedora o en la distribució de Red Hat Linux a nivell empresarial, substituïu-la amb a l'ordre anterior. Si no el podeu trobar, proveu més l'ordre per trobar a quin directori s’emmagatzemen els missatges del sistema. Si voleu veure tot el syslog i no només el final final, feu servir més o més a l’indicador CLI i, a continuació, premeu la barra espaiadora cada vegada que vulgueu baixar una pàgina d’informació.

Mètode 2: comprovació de la informació del gestor de xarxa

Des d'una interfície d'indicador d'ordres, proveu d'emetre l'ordre nmcli nm wifi off. Això hauria d'apagar l'adaptador de xarxa. Un cop ho hàgiu fet, proveu nmcli nm wifi per tornar-lo a engegar i reinicieu l'ordinador. És possible que necessiteu l'accés root per reiniciar l'ordinador mitjançant sudo reboot o, com a alternativa, potser haureu de restablir-lo amb la GUI. Escriure reiniciar a la CLI i prémer enter pot ser suficient en els sistemes Ubuntu, però no per a Debian.

Un cop es faci una còpia de seguretat del sistema, comproveu si això ha corregit el problema. Si no ho ha fet, executeu lspci -knn | grep Net -A2 i mireu la informació que proporciona.

Això us indicarà si la màquina realment s’està relacionant amb l’adaptador Wi-Fi o no i si ha de proporcionar informació més que suficient per corregir el problema. Si ara heu descartat completament els problemes de maquinari i creieu que realment podria ser un problema amb el controlador, és possible que hagueu d’instal·lar un controlador de font tancada. Haureu de seguir les instruccions del vostre fabricant si feu una distribució que no inclogui material de font tancada als dipòsits, llavors hauríeu de posar-vos en contacte amb el fabricant o cercar en un fòrum web un paquet instal·lable que s'adapta al vostre adaptador. No obstant això, els usuaris d’Ubuntu i els seus diversos derivats oficials reconeguts per Canonical com Lubuntu, Xubuntu i Kubuntu tenen un darrer recurs.

Mètode 3: cerca automàtica de controladors de codi tancat

Si utilitzeu alguna de les diverses distribucions * buntu, proveu d’obrir Programes i actualitzacions des del menú Dash, LXDE o Whisker. A la primera pestanya que s'obre automàticament, seleccioneu 'Programari lliure i de codi obert compatible amb Canonical (principal)', 'Programari lliure i de codi obert (univers) gestionat per la comunitat', 'Controladors propietaris de dispositius (restringit)' i 'Programari restringit per drets d'autor o per qüestions legals (multivers)' de la llista de comprovació. És possible que algunes caselles ja estiguin marcades i, si les marqueu, us pot demanar que introduïu la vostra contrasenya.

El programa us pot indicar que actualitzeu els dipòsits. Si aquest és el cas, deixeu-lo executar el curs fent clic al botó Accepta. Tingueu en compte que això pot trigar una estona i, en general, requereix que tingueu capacitats de xarxa. Si és possible, utilitzeu un cable Ethernet per connectar el dispositiu directament a un mòdem o enrutador fins que la connexió WiFi funcioni. Un cop executat, seleccioneu la pestanya Controladors addicionals.

El nom del fabricant de maquinari que es visualitza al mètode núm. 2 pot aparèixer en aquest quadre i podeu utilitzar el controlador fent clic a Aplica els canvis. Si es diu 'No hi ha controladors addicionals disponibles' i teniu connexió de xarxa mitjançant un cable físic, és possible que hàgiu de tancar-la i reiniciar-la. Si encara no hi ha res, executeu sudo apt-get update al terminal mentre disposeu de capacitats de xarxa des d’una connexió física i, a continuació, executeu sudo apt-get upgrade abans d’obrir de nou Programes i actualitzacions. És possible que se us demani que respongueu de manera interactiva a algunes sol·licituds del terminal mentre executeu aquestes ordres CLI i és possible que el vostre sistema actualitzi altres paquets no relacionats. Un cop finalitzats, se us ha de donar l'opció d'instal·lar el controlador propietari.

Si això provoca un problema no relacionat o un controlador de codi obert posteriorment està disponible i preferiu eliminar el codi de font tancat del vostre sistema, sempre podeu utilitzar el botó Revertir del full Controladors addicionals per purgar-lo.

4 minuts de lectura